    According to Statista 2021, total retail sales, both online and offline, amounted to 24.2 trillion USD, out of which 19.1 trillion USD was generated by the brick and mortar retail channel and around 4.9 trillion USD was generated by the eCommerce sales channel. In the same year, global retail sales accounted for a growth of 9.7% as a whole and eCommerce accounted for around 19.6% of total retail sales.

    Which Has Lesser Prior Investment?

    Ecommerce
    Starting an eCommerce business may sound like an expensive process but with proper planning and execution, one can start running it on a budget. The investment required to start your eCommerce business in India is nearly 5-10 lakh rupees. It includes building your business website, hosting, domain, sales and management tools, web development, and advertisements.

    Retail
    Investment in setting up a retail store can be an expensive process. A retail store has to invest in various things before selling its product. These include building, buying, or renting a store, paying license fees, hiring staff for multiple positions, paying location tax, investing in filling up the store with sufficient items to attract a customer, and other necessary resources relating to business and government. All such expenses make setting up a retail store far more expensive than starting an eCommerce store.

    So, comparatively, the cost of investment is lower in the case of eCommerce than in retail. The advantage of owning an eCommerce store is that it reduces the cost of setting up a brick-and-mortar store or hiring delivery staff. This is because eCommerce stores send their manufactured products to branches such as Amazon, FedEx, Ship Bob, Flipkart, etc. for order fulfilment. After this, it is the responsibility of these branches to pack, track and send the order to the buyer.

    Best Time to Send Newsletters

    Most people open the newsletters between 10 am and 12 pm (depending on the subscriber’s time zone). Many industry analysts have lauded these times as ideal for sending newsletters because the subscribers have settled into their day and aren’t too preoccupied with their regular duties to ignore their inboxes. According to the statistics, higher open rates are also seen around 5–6 pm. Now, let’s glance at each weekday to see when the most people open their newsletters.

    ● Monday- On a Monday, the peak time for people to check their newsletters is 10 am, with a nice little bump between 5–7 pm, according to the data. Open, and click-through rates decline slightly in the mid-afternoon, maybe when individuals shake off the “Monday blues” and get back to work.

    ● Tuesday- Newsletter openings peak around 10 am, remain relatively stable throughout the afternoon, and decline after 6 pm. This could be because subscribers have developed a weekly ritual of reading their emails and then logging off at the end of the day.

    ● Wednesday- Wednesday’s open and click-through rates follow a trend identical to Tuesday’s, with a sharper drop after 6 pm as individuals turn off their devices, begin their drive home, and spend time with family and friends.

    ● Thursday- Although 10 am remains the best hour for open rates, there is also a slight surge between 1–3 pm on Thursdays. This could be because people spend their lunch hour searching for something to do as the week draws to a close.

    ● Friday- Open rates are typically high from 10–11 am, with another increase around 2 pm. This is a fun day to send a newsletter since it catches the folks right before they leave for the weekend when they’re most likely to buy something new or start something different.

    While open and click-through rates are consistent across all weekdays, research shows that Tuesdays and Thursdays top the pack. Also, 10 am appears to be the best time to send newsletters for optimum open and click-through rates. According to these statistics, the worst time to send a newsletter is on weekends, 9 am or 9 pm when subscribers are hustling to be ready for the new day, shutting off for the evening, or sleeping.

    Modification of Time As Per Your Audience

    Knowing and understanding the audience demographics is one of the most critical steps to achieving newsletter marketing success. Almost every company globally wants the same thing regarding newsletter marketing. It is the ability to send the appropriate message to the appropriate person at the appropriate time.

    Subscribers have a variety of interests, habits, and requirements. Sending out mass communication newsletters simultaneously to everyone can never satisfy those needs. Knowing the demographics of the audience helps to send more relevant campaigns. Open rates and click-throughs will skyrocket if a company’s newsletter marketing efforts become more audience relevant.

    Here are some illustrations of how demographics can overrule typical “best time to send” recommendations:

    ● If a business tries to reach a young, tech-savvy audience, it will undoubtedly disregard the standard rule about avoiding sending emails late at night. Evening emails may be appropriate for younger audiences.

    ● The much-maligned Friday can be a terrific pick for a business in the entertainment industry because people are always looking for entertaining things to do over the weekend.

    ● Weekends don’t have to be off-limits. If a business wants to reach out to tech-savvy audiences, entrepreneurs, or students, weekends can be a good time.

    Understanding the behavior, preferences, and time zones of the target demographics can assist in determining the optimal day and time to send a newsletter. It is also important that a business should tailor newsletter sending times based on the location of the subscribers for best results.

    Types of Marketplaces

    Are you sure about the category of the marketplace? Let’s understand the classification of the marketplaces. Depending upon the type of marketplace, the cost of development is affected. The marketplace is divided into two parts that affect the eCommerce marketplace development cost.

    Based on Participants

    The target audience and the intention of the buyer-seller relationship decide your marketplace, which can be one of the following:

    B2C Marketplaces: It offers an opportunity to vendors to sell products directly to the consumers. B2C marketplaces are generally monetized by listing fees, commissions, subscription fees, etc. For instance, booking.com.

    B2B Marketplaces: It provides an opportunity for manufacturers to sell products or services. A third party usually operates them. Their motive is to promote transparency in deals and buying/selling processes. These are monetized through listing fees, commission, subscription fees, etc. For instance, eWorldTrade, and Alibaba.

    C2C or P2P Marketplaces: These marketplaces connect people to share their products and services in exchange for money, such as a car. The motive behind C2C marketplaces is for maximum utilisation of resources, which are monetized through paid ads and promotions. For instance, Etsy, OLX.

    Ecommerce Marketplace: It allows individuals and multiple businesses to sell their products and services online to consumers. These marketplaces are the most popular imaging eCommerce marketplace development cost. Example: Amazon, eBay.

    mCommerce or Mobile Marketplaces: These are designed to facilitate mobile shopping. These are digital stores monetized through subscription fees, commission fees, freemium plans, lead fees, and listing fees. Example: Upwork, Fiverr, Sephora.

    Crowdfunding Marketplaces: It allows its members to raise funds from the groups for a specific project. Monetization strategies include transaction fees and commission fees. Example: Kickstarter, Indiegogo.

    Auction Platforms: They encourage vendors to fulfil the services by bidding. It exclusively helps to gain the most competitive rates for a specific item or service. Auction platforms monetize through transaction fees. Example: Artsy.

    Based on Business Model

    The structure of your marketplace depends upon the business model. The business model defines the strategies to attract buyers and sellers and generate revenue. It helps determine the essential functionality and even affects the marketplace development cost. Business models are classified into three groups:

    Horizontal marketplaces: They deal in different categories to different consumers. consumers can find all the necessary products. Here the competition is fierce, and a wider audience is covered. Example: OLX, Etsy

    Vertical Marketplace: Instead of selling every product to everyone, these are mainly focused on niche services or products. Here you experience less competition. Additionally, you can focus on delivering better personalization. Example: StockX

    Global Marketplace: It allows the exchange of goods and services worldwide. It has the widest audience and hence more power to generate revenue. You will face some language barriers and legal constraints in the global marketplace. Example: amazon.com, ebay.com

    What Is Cash Flow?

    As a business owner, you understand the importance of staying on top of your cash flow to keep your business sustained. But what exactly does cash flow mean? In simple words, cash flow refers to the net amount of money flowing in and out of a company.

    Every organisation’s success is mainly dependent on how positive its cash flow is. A positive cash flow is when a company brings in more money than it sends out. The cash that goes out of the company generally consists of debts and other expenses.

    Ways To Improve Your Business Cash Flow

    In order to sustain itself in the business industry, the key ingredient is to always keep positive cash flow. Staying on top of your cash flow allows you to see the broader picture, wherein you will be able to scope out areas of improvement and work on the same.

    Opt For Leasing Instead Of Purchasing

    Your business’ daily expenses are going to be divided into different categories. All these categories will be required to be fulfilled whenever they are due. Apart from that, every business needs some money in hand for day-to-day operations. This includes supplies, types of equipment, and your entire workplace. In such cases, opting to lease all these things will leave you with enough money at the end of the day.

    When you lease, you pay for the leased commodity in smaller increments from time to time. This saves you from spending all your money at the same time. Leasing is a proven way to help increase cash flow. Moreover, since lease payments come under business expenses, they can always be written off your taxes.

    Buying, on the contrary, will cause you to spend all your money at once, leaving you with little to nothing when in need. Therefore, unless your business is booming with cash, it is always better to lease instead of buy.

    Nespresso

    Nespresso is one of the most successful operating units of Nestle Group with its headquarters based in Lausanne, Switzerland. The company is known for its premium machines that brew coffee from coffee capsules. Nespresso machines are designed to help its customers make a premium cup of coffee in an easier and fast manner. Nespresso also sells its premium coffee capsules that are made from the best quality coffee and manufactured in three Switzerland factories.

    As of 2011, the company’s annual sales were over 3 billion Swiss francs. George Clooney was signed as a Nespresso brand ambassador in 2006, since then the actor is known to receive $40 million from Nespresso endorsement deals. The acclaimed actors have been the face of the brand since 2006 and have appeared in many multimedia ad campaigns that have garnered popularity and helped the brand grow in the European and US market.

    George Clooney has paired up with other actors like John Malkovich, Danny DeVito, and Matt Damon to endorse Nespresso in commercials. George Clooney was also noted to serve as a member of the Nespresso Sustainability Advisory Board. His role was to collaborate on ideas and solutions for improving the lives and futures of coffee farmers.

    Casamigos

    Casamigos is a popular tequila company that was co-founded by George Clooney and his friends Rande Gerber and Mike Meldman and launched in 2013. The tequila brand was said to be accidentally founded as the friends only wanted to make a tequila according to their tastes and for their personal use, with no intention of taking the company public.

    The company, however, became incredibly popular and was acquired by Diageo (the world’s largest spirits company) for a whopping $1 billion in 2017. The purchase was equivalent to Diageo paying almost $500 a bottle. George Clooney went on a US road trip to promote the launch of the Casamigos Tequila.

    The actor also appeared in an ad commercial and the supermodel Cindy Crawford, Rande Gerber’s wife. The funny commercial showcases Clooney waking up next to Crawford with a puzzled expression. A bottle of Casamigos Tequila on the nightstand behind him ends with a message saying “Please drink responsibly”.

    A Brief History of Red Bull

    The Red Bull logo and slogan
    The Red Bull’s logo and slogan

    Red Bull is an Austrian energy drink company created in 1987, when the Austrian entrepreneur Dietrich Mateschitsz was inspired by an already existing local energy drink which was sold in Thailand. The local energy drink was meant to help keep drinkers awake and alert. He took this idea, modified its ingredients to match the westerner’s taste buds, partnered with Chaleo Yoovidhya and together founded the Red Bull company in 1987 in Chakkapong, Thailand.

    The product was later taken to Austria where it had its first ground breaking success in no time and soon went international after it blew up in Hungary. When the company originally started it only had only a single flavor and regular or Sugar free formulas, a line of different fruit flavors were added by 2013. The company’s slogan is “Red Bull gives you wings.” Red Bull is currently in more than 170 countries energizing the population and raising the competition along the way. According to Forbes it is also the 61stmost valuable brand in the world.

    When Red Bull first came out, it was the first and only as back then energy drinks dint exist. And since traditional means of advertising was expensive, Red Bull had to come up with a different marketing strategy. They simply targeted their target audience which is 18 to 35 years old in different college parties, bars, coffee shops and even libraries. At these events and places the people were given free samples, which lead to the people talking and spreading the word about the product for free. Red Bull started sponsoring music festivals and sport event, campaigns and also created good quality content which got the company its fame.

    Stratos Space Diving Project

    Red Bull Stratos space diving project

    In the year of 2012, Red Bull hit the global headlines when it decided to try and break the record which at that time stood for 62 years. The company sponsored an event where an Austrian skydiver Felix Baumgartner to free fall jump from the Earth stratosphere in a helium balloon. This project was known as the stratos project, because Baumgartner had to fly approximately 39 kilometers (24 miles) into the stratosphere over New Mexico in a helium balloon before free falling in a pressure suit and then parachuting to Earth.

    After it became successful Baumgartner broke three records including being the first person to break the speed of sound during a captivating freefall that lasted for four minutes and 19 seconds. This event was live streamed through YouTube with the help of GoPro cameras and became the most viewed live stream and a mainstream media platform at that time. This event embodied the company’s slogan, the brand vision and supplied Red Bull with unique photography that would be used in its marketing campaign for years.

    The Impact of Red Bull’s Marketing Campaigns

    The stratos project generated a huge number of media attention and a media coverage worth an estimation of tens of million, which would not be possible to reach just using the traditional marketing strategy. After this project the company increased 7% of its sales in just six months generating $1.6 billion and selling 5.2 billion cans in the following year.

    This project was successful because the company put science, engineering and a huge budget which was 1/10th of its annual global marketing budget which was $330 million to fund the project. This led the company to win a Sports Emmy in the category of an outstanding new approach to sports event coverage. The point of this project was to inspire the youth to use their wings and try doing what they taught was impossible and push the human boundaries.

    The total broadcast was over 3 hours long and the Red Bull’s logo was in every shot. The Stratos campaign is an extreme but excellent example of creative marketing, and the company’s commitment to the values and aesthetic that the brand created when they first got their start that makes their marketing work. Everything they create relates back to the idea of giving people and ideas wings to fly.
